A soldier doesn’t fight because he hates what is in front of him, but because he loves what is behind him.

From the icy terrain of Himalaya to the scorching heat of the desert, they guard us as their family all day and night without complaining. It will be fair to say, while these soldiers are making sure of the peace and safety of every citizen, we should respect every soldier, who has and is serving our country.

From the dawn of our independence, they have been guarding us against the intruders, terrorists, and other external attacks. Since 1947, we have faced several major wars and in each case, even in the worst condition, we have snatched victory from enemies with the help of our powerful, devotional, and extremely talented Indian Army.

This poem was written for the Pulwama attack which was one of the deadliest terror attacks in Jammu and Kashmir on 14th February 2019. The attack resulted in the deaths of our 40 CRPF soldiers. Nevertheless, I believe no day should go by when we should not remind ourselves of the soldiers who suffer and bear the deepest wounds and scars of war. For, the nation which forgets its defenders will itself be forgotten.
